Infor Welcomes its New CEO Charles Philips: What’s In Store for Infor?
In the last months of 2010, business software company Infor named their new Chief Executive Officer with no other than former oracle Co-President Charles Phillips. Phillips left his position in Oracle in September of 2010 and was replaced by the ousted CEO of Hewlett-Packard, Mark Hurd. Apparently, Phillips informed oracle CEO Lawrence Ellison on his exit from Oracle and he totally respects his decision and Phillips is just enthralled to work at a new environment with new challenges to conquer. The CEO of Infor, Jim Schaper will step down as Chairman and will still continue to play a vital role for Infor’s success.

Presently, Infor has been the third largest enterprise resource software solutions all over the world, and who knows, with Phillips on their turf, they might have a shot for the elusive top spot. Charles Phillips is known as the master of acquisitions as he had acquired quite a handful of them during his time with Oracle. He might just be the catalyst that Infor needs to lay out a plan that shall surge for its global success. To date, Infor has seventy companies and seventy thousand customers. Now with Phillips as CEO, they hope he will be an instrument to see this number go up by hundreds and even by thousands.
